solar vintage, we will become silhouettes

by Elena Corchero. A collection of accessories for the eco-fashion-minded in which technology meets tradition. Explores delicate ways of incorporating organic solar cells and other electronic components into textiles. Embroideries and prints recall endangered birds. The pieces are charged while used outdoors during the day. In the evening they transform into a decorative ambient light display for the home. From Siggraph, Unravel, 2007.

As well as showcasing computer graphics, the Siggraph exhibition has also hosted a fashion show featuring garments augmented by technology. The aim was to show that the merging of textiles and technology can be elegant and need not resemble a robot’s cast offs.
